The 19 best towns and cities to work in Britain
Places of all sizes all over the UK make it onto the list, but surprisingly London is not one of them.
Glassdoor's new job report measures three key features to determine an area's "jobs score," which is marked out of five:
- How easy it is to get a job (hiring opportunity).
- How affordable it is to live there (cost of living).
- How satisfied employees are working there (overall job satisfaction).
Glassdoor's chief economist Dr. Andrew Chamberlain said in a statement:
"These results are a reminder that although there are more jobs in London and employees are generally pretty satisfied, it is a competitive place to work and an expensive place to live. Towns and cities such as Nottingham, Leeds, and Reading offer decent salaries and job prospects combined with a lower cost of living which means your money will go further, you can save, and still and have a good quality of life."
